Output 66e1c83925824cd22073dabf6cda692fdd31cc954376fa1bf25ea807c14c9920:0

value
29670085
script pubkey
OP_0 OP_PUSHBYTES_20 6ab86163df70aabd72c5fadac644a47b8a2297e1
address
ltc1qd2uxzc7lwz4t6uk9ltdvv39y0w9z99lp07ndmk
transaction
66e1c83925824cd22073dabf6cda692fdd31cc954376fa1bf25ea807c14c9920
spent
true